Abstract

The invention discloses selenium-rich germinated brown rice snowflake rice flakes and a processing method of the selenium-rich germinated brown rice snowflake rice flakes. The selenium-rich germinated brown rice snowflake rice flakes comprise the following raw materials in percentage by weight: 15-24% of selenium-rich germinated brown rice, 23-29% of milled rice with embryo, 13-22% of buckwheat, 16-25% of maltodextrin, 3-13% of pumpkin powder, 4-9% of semen sesami nigrum and 3-7% of xylitol. The processing method comprises the following steps in sequence: grinding the raw materials, adding water for stirring, grinding by gum, saccharifying and carrying out pregelatinization, drying the raw materials by using a steam rotary drum, crushing and separating, drying the raw materials in the air to obtain the selenium-rich germinated brown rice snowflake rice flakes of 5-7 meshes. The selenium-rich germinated brown rice snowflake rice flakes are fresh in taste, rich in nutrition, balanced in energy, instant to brew and drink, and convenient to eat.

Detailed description of the invention
A kind of selenium-rich germinated brown rice snowflake rice sheet that the present invention proposes, its raw materials by weight comprises: 15 ~ 24% selenium-rich germinated brown rices, 23 ~ 29% rice germs, 13 ~ 22% buckwheats, 16 ~ 25% maltodextrins, 3 ~ 13% pumpkin powders, 4 ~ 9% Semen sesami nigrums, 3 ~ 7% xylitols.
Based on above-mentioned selenium-rich germinated brown rice snowflake rice sheet, the present invention proposes a kind of processing method according to described selenium-rich germinated brown rice snowflake rice sheet, comprise the steps:
S1, to take selenium-rich germinated brown rice, rice germ, buckwheat and Semen sesami nigrum by proportioning and carry out grinding and obtain powder;
S2, the maltodextrin adding proportioning in described powder, pumpkin powder and xylitol the stirring that adds water obtains thickener, water temperature is 30 ~ 40 DEG C, and mixing time is 15 ~ 20min;
Described thickener is carried out glue mill and obtains abrasive material by S3;
S4, described abrasive material is delivered to steam roller tube drying machine storage material groove in carry out saccharification and pre-gelatinized obtains slurry; The drum surface temperature of described steam roller tube drying machine is set more than 145 DEG C;
S5, the cylinder surface described slurry being spread upon steam roller tube drying machine carry out drying, the thickness smearing epithelium is 1.8 ~ 2.2mm, the drum surface temperature arranging steam roller tube drying machine is 145 DEG C ~ 155 DEG C, in the cylinder of steam roller tube drying machine, steam pressure is 6 ~ 9MPa, and the moisture being dried to epithelium is 3 ~ 7% take off and obtain skin graft;
S6, to described skin graft pulverizing separation obtain former of 5 ~ 7 objects;
S7, in air drier, carry out drying by described former and obtain described selenium-rich germinated brown rice snowflake rice sheet.
Wherein, in S1, the fineness of described powder is the percent of pass of every 100 eye mesh screens is more than 85%, and this can make powder reach the swollen profit effect of water suction preferably in shorter mixing time, and can improve the utilization rate of raw material, increases follow-up pre-gelatinized degree;
In S2, consider the swollen profit effect of the water suction of powder, adopt limit to add the mode of waterside stirring, stir 15 ~ 20min at the warm water of 30 DEG C ~ about 40 DEG C, preferably under 34 ~ 36 DEG C of water temperatures, stir 16 ~ 18min, stirring concentration has predetermined viscosity with slurry and predetermined mobility is advisable.
In S3, the honed journey of glue not only can make all raw materials reach good mixed effect, and water-fast oil substances can be mixed with water, makes slurry be similar to emulsification, and makes the fineness that slurry reaches predetermined, can improve the quality of product;
In S4, saccharification react can improve color and luster and the mouthfeel of product, material after pre-gelatinized is convenient to drying and moulding, improve the utilization rate of heat energy and the production output of product, the steam roller tube drying machine wherein used has stronger heat endurance, its comparable saccharification and pre-gelatinized degree being easier to control slurry, thus reach the object controlling product color;
In S5, dry run uses steam roller tube drying machine to carry out drying, and the material through saccharification and pre-gelatinized can be made to obtain abundant slaking and better drying effect;
In S6, the granular size of selenium-rich germinated brown rice snowflake rice sheet is determined by regulating the density of comminutor screen cloth; Particularly, described skin graft is put into pulverizer coarse crushing, be then placed in comminutor carry out powder sheet be separated obtain former of 5-7 object;
In S7, carry out redrying to former, thus play resultant effect that is former, auxiliary material color better, extend the shelf life.

Embodiment 1
A kind of selenium-rich germinated brown rice snowflake rice sheet that the present embodiment 1 proposes, its raw materials by weight comprises: 15% selenium-rich germinated brown rice, 29% rice germ, 13% buckwheat, 25% maltodextrin, 3% pumpkin powder, 9% Semen sesami nigrum, 6% xylitol.
The processing method of the rice of selenium-rich germinated brown rice snowflake described in the present embodiment 1 sheet comprises the steps:
S1, to take described selenium-rich germinated brown rice, rice germ, buckwheat and Semen sesami nigrum carry out grinding and obtain powder by proportioning, it is more than 85% that described flour crosses 100 eye mesh screen percent of pass;
S2, the maltodextrin adding proportioning in institute's powder is stated, pumpkin powder and xylitol the stirring that adds water obtains thickener, wherein water temperature is 30 DEG C, fully stirs stand for standby use after 20min;
S3, the described thickener that S2 is obtained put into colloid mill carry out glue mill obtain abrasive material;
S4, the described abrasive material obtained by S3 are delivered in the storage material groove of steam roller tube drying machine and are carried out saccharification and pre-gelatinized obtains slurry, and the surface temperature of steam roller tube drying machine is 155 DEG C;
S5, the cylinder surface slurry obtained in S4 being spread upon steam roller tube drying machine carry out drying, the thickness smearing epithelium is 1.9mm, the drum surface temperature of steam roller tube drying machine is 150 DEG C, in the cylinder of steam roller tube drying machine, steam pressure is 6MPa, and the moisture being dried to epithelium is 2.9% take off and obtain skin graft;
S6, pulverizer coarse crushing is put into skin graft described in S5, be then placed in comminutor and carry out powder sheet and be separated and obtain former of 5 ~ 7 objects;
S7, S6 is obtained former in air drier, carry out drying, obtain described selenium-rich germinated brown rice snowflake rice sheet.
